A balance sheet presents a company's financial position at a particular date through assets, liabilities, and net assets or equity. It shows what the company controls, what it owes, and the residual ownership interest.

Answer (d)

Why not others:
- cash movements by activity appear in the cash-flow statement

- revenue, expenses, and period performance appear in the income statement

- changes in net assets over a period appear in the statement of changes in equity

Key rule: The balance sheet is a point-in-time statement satisfying assets = liabilities + equity.
